    Have you guys seen this?! Total game changer

    I have about 70k miles on my x6 5.0, and 1 year left on my warranty. I absolutely love the car and would hate to part with it. I don’t like the way the new body styles look. But I figure that the valve stem seals are just a matter of time, and that job is 8k. But now it looks like you can do a new engine swap!!

    I almost bought a 2013 X6 50i with 46K miles on it few months ago, but all these horror stories on the net about all the problems of N63 scared me away.. I mean, I know every car has problems, but it seams like the heat from the turbos is the main cause of all the problems related to N63, and that's there to stay (the heat I mean). No CCP will change the heat of the turbos, right? So, I'm mostly scared that replacing all faulty parts on a used N63, all the problems WILL come back sooner or later (because the main cause, the heat, was not resolved). Even putting a new engine in the car... so I started looking at either 35i or the M. But after looking for a while, and test driving few, I still go back to the 50i (the 35i seems rather week for the size of the car, and the M seems rather expensive , and at the end, they may have similair issues )...
